Karen has been knitting for well over 20 years. After discussing her interest in learning to knit, her mom took her into a Markham yarn shop, bought a pattern and large ball of yarn and taught her to knit. She was immediately hooked!
Karen is intrigued with learning new things, especially new and different knitting techniques. She is drawn to textured knitting stitches and such things as cable patterns, aran knitting and lace stitches. She loves working with her fellow knitters and enjoys the knowledge-sharing process that so naturally occurs.
Karen took early retirement from a career in the insurance industry and has been an active member of the Toronto knitting guild, the Downtown Knit Collective, for over 10 years.
